Welcome to the Tilegrove team! Our tile-rendering cache layer (codename Slatecache) sits between the renderer and object storage, keeping hot map tiles in memory with an LRU eviction policy. When reviewing PRs, watch for cache-key changes — they silently invalidate everything. To run Slatecache locally, copy env.sample to .env and start the dev compose stack. One thing the sample omits: the cache-auth secret, so append that line to your .env now.

secret setting of hawep-yahig: LEDGER_TOKEN29=41b5d6315371c92885eaeb077fb63

Receiving site (Corvid Hall loading dock): confirm arrival of three flight cases from Brightmoor Scenic containing the mechanical moon rig, the breakaway staircase panels, and the prop crate labelled Act II. Check seals against the manifest, note any transit damage on the condition sheet, and store the cases upright in the dry bay — the moon rig cannot lie flat. Do not open the Act II crate; production manager Odile Ferrant will do that herself. Before the courier departs, apply the hand-over instruction noted directly below.

dispatch memo: the eliath belael courier leaves the praox ledger at gate 8841 under passcode 017589

MEMO — Launch Plan: Corvel Array

Welcome aboard. Ahead of your first steering review, here is where the Corvel Array launch stands. Manufacturing at the Dunmere plant is tracking to plan, with certification expected three weeks before the go-live window. Marketing assets are approved; the channel team in Hallowick is mid-way through partner onboarding. Two open risks remain: firmware validation timing and the pricing tier for education accounts. Both are flagged in the appendix. Before circulating anything further, please read the note below.

board note of kageg-bahof: The renewal with Holwynax Holdings closes at $2 million a year, 5 percent below the last contract. Project Ulaath slips by two quarters because of the supplier delay.

## Tuning

If Fareloom starts misquoting shipping fees under load, it's almost always the rule-cache settings, not the rules themselves. Resist the urge to restart the evaluator first — flush the cache and watch the hit rate for a few minutes. If you do need to adjust anything, stick to the sanctioned knobs listed here.

limits module of tafop-hahop:
WEIGHTS = {
    "julmir": 223,
    "belox": 987,
    "lamion": 470,
    "pelath": 609,
    "fraok": 1010,
    "eliion": 343,
    "drudor": 342,
}